Without good manners and etiquette, the world becomes a rude and chaotic mess.
The importance of manners in life cannot be overstated, but I’d like to point out a few of the most powerful benefits.
1. INSTILLS CONFIDENCE
We gain confidence by identifying the right thing to do in any given situation—and then doing it.
When you understand basic social manners, you know how to act appropriately, which helps alleviate doubt and self-consciousness.
2. MAKES THE BEST FIRST IMPRESSION
First impressions are important. They set the stage for future relationships and opportunities.
When you meet someone new, they don’t know anything about you. Naturally, assumptions are made based on how you carry yourself and behave—both in speech and manner.
3. OPENS DOORS TO OPPORTUNITIES
Perhaps it’s a controversial opinion, but I believe good manners can open doors that even the best education cannot.
One of the many benefits of having good manners is the unforeseen, potentially life-changing opportunities made possible by them.
4. CULTIVATES A HEART FOR OTHERS
Think about manners in action. They look like:
Holding the door for others
Offering help
Chewing with your mouth closed
Making eye contact during conversation
At the very root of good manners is a heart that is fixed on others before self.
5. SAFEGUARDS AGAINST SELFISHNESS
Selfishness ruins relationships and damages reputations.
Not only that, it breeds loneliness. After all, no one wants to be around people who only care about themselves.
It’s practically impossible to be mindful of others and selfish at the same time.
6. SPARKS JOY
There is great joy in helping others. While happiness is based on happen-stance, joy can be had no matter the circumstances.
Deep satisfaction comes from knowing your actions and mannerisms are having a positive impact on those around you.
7. INSPIRES RECIPROCATION
We don’t practice good manners because we expect reciprocation, but it’s often a benefit nonetheless.
It’s easy to be nice to others when they’re nice to us.
We’re more willing to share with others when they share with us.
8. LAYS THE FOUNDATION FOR SUCCESS IN LIFE
It takes more than hard work to be successful in life. When you pair that hard work with good manners, you create a dynamic duo that can plow through any obstacle.
Proper etiquette (beyond the dining table) is admirable, and what people admire, they also respect.
9. FOSTERS BETTER RELATIONSHIPS
What kind of people do you want to be friends with? To work with?
Most likely, they wouldn’t be people who are rude, self-serving, loud-mouthed, and overall unpleasant.
It’s natural to be drawn toward people who are polite, friendly, and mindful of others.
Good relationships are a key to living in harmony, and social etiquette lays the groundwork to positive interactions that can eventually develop into those relationships.
